How Three Roaming works in Spain

Three UK includes roaming at no extra cost in Spain and 70 other destinations under Go Roam. If you pay for a Three monthly plan (not Pay As You Go), your UK data allowance travels with you. For example, if you have 100 GB in the UK, you can use 100 GB in Spain without additional charges during the first stretch.

Fair Use Policy: Three lets you use your plan in Spain up to a maximum of 12 GB per month (if your plan has ≥12 GB) or your full plan amount if smaller. Beyond that, they charge £3 per additional GB — expensive compared with local data.

Speed: Three doesn't apply initial throttling, but the network used in Spain (Movistar or Orange, depending on location) has variable coverage. In coastal tourist zones (Benidorm, Málaga, Valencia) speed is typically stable; in rural interior areas (Extremadura, Castilla-La Mancha) signal can be spotty.

Maximum duration: Three allows Go Roam use for up to 63 consecutive days outside the UK. Stay longer and they may reclassify you as a permanent international user and suspend roaming.

Go Roam Europe Pass: $2.40 per day for short trips

If your Three plan does NOT include Go Roam (some basic Pay As You Go plans don't), you can buy the Go Roam Europe Pass: $2.40 per day, giving you access to your UK data allowance for 24 hours.

Real cost for one week: 7 days × $2.40 = $16.80. Works well for 3–5 day trips where you don't need much data. But for two weeks you pay $33.60, and if you exceed 12 GB total in the month, each extra GB costs £3.

Activation: the pass activates automatically when you connect to a Spanish network. You can't turn it off manually — if your phone connects, you're charged for the full day.

Real coverage in Spain: Movistar vs Orange

Three UK roams with Movistar as the primary operator in Spain, Orange as secondary where Movistar has no coverage. At eSIM Ahora our Spanish plans also use these two networks, so coverage is practically identical:

  • Movistar: covers 98.5% of Spain's population and 92% of territory. Excellent on highways (A1–A7) and major cities (Madrid, Barcelona, Valencia, Seville). Weak in Pyrenees and Iberian System mountain zones.
  • Orange: covers 97% of population, with better signal on the Mediterranean coast (Valencia, Murcia, eastern Andalusia) than Movistar. In interior Galicia and rural Asturias can have gaps.

If you travel the Route of Don Quixote (central Castilla-La Mancha) or Extremadura villages, both Three and eSIM Ahora will have spotty coverage — that's a rural infrastructure issue, not the provider's fault.

Common Three Roaming problems in Spain

Unexpected charge for a full Europe Pass day: if your Three plan does NOT include free Go Roam (some basic Pay As You Go plans don't), your phone can automatically activate the Europe Pass (£2/day) when it connects to a Spanish network, even if you only use 10 MB. Disable data roaming before traveling if you're unsure of your plan.

12 GB limit shared across all Go Roam destinations: if you use 8 GB in France then go to Spain, you only have 4 GB left for Spain in that month. Three counts usage across all Go Roam countries, not per country.

Throttling after exceeding the limit: if you pay the £3/GB overage, Three can apply throttling (reduced speed to 384 kbps) per their fair use policy. It's not publicly documented, but users report speed drops after consuming >20 GB in roaming per month.

Suspension after 63 days: Three auto-detects if you stay more than 63 days outside the UK. On a long European road trip, they can suspend Go Roam without warning. For stays of several months, a local prepaid eSIM is safer.

Does Three charge for roaming in Spain in 2026?

No, if you have a Three UK monthly plan with Go Roam included. Roaming in Spain is free up to the 12 GB/month fair use limit. Exceed that and you pay £3 per extra GB. Basic Pay As You Go plans may require the Europe Pass ($2.40 per day).

How much data does Three Roaming include in Spain?

Up to 12 GB per month if your UK plan has ≥12 GB, or your full plan total if smaller. For example, an 8 GB plan gives you 8 GB in Spain; a 100 GB plan gives you only 12 GB in Spain. The 12 GB limit is shared across all Go Roam destinations (not 12 GB per country).

Can I use Three Roaming in Spain for more than two months straight?

Yes, up to 63 consecutive days. Stay longer and Three may reclassify you as a permanent international user and suspend roaming. For long stays (study, remote work, sabbatical) a local prepaid eSIM with no time limit makes more sense.

Does eSIM work on iPhone and Android?

Yes, on compatible devices. iPhones from XS/XR (2018) onward support eSIM. Android from 2019 (Samsung S20, Google Pixel 3, Huawei P40) also support it. Check your device maker's specs before buying. Chinese iPhones sold in mainland China don't have active eSIM.

Do I need to turn off Three UK when using the eSIM in Spain?

Not required, but recommended. Set your Three UK for calls and SMS only (disable mobile data on that line) and the eSIM for data. This prevents accidental roaming charges if your phone switches networks. On iOS: Settings > Cellular Data > select eSIM as the data line. On Android: Settings > Network & Internet > SIM > choose eSIM for mobile data.
